A Part Time Remote Data Analyst collects, processes, and analyzes data to help businesses make informed decisions while working remotely and on a part-time schedule. Responsibilities often include cleaning datasets, creating reports, and identifying trends using statistical tools. This role is ideal for individuals who excel at data interpretation and want flexibility in their work hours. Common industries hiring for this position include finance, healthcare, e-commerce, and marketing. Strong skills in Excel, SQL, Python, or R are typically required.
To thrive as a Part Time Remote Data Analyst, a strong foundation in data analysis, statistical methods, and attention to detail is essential, typically supported by a relevant degree or coursework in data science, statistics, or a related field. Proficiency with analytical tools such as Excel, SQL, Python, or business intelligence platforms, as well as familiarity with data visualization software and data privacy best practices, is generally expected. Strong communication, time management, and problem-solving abilities help remote analysts effectively interpret data, meet deadlines, and present actionable insights to stakeholders. These skills ensure accurate, insightful analysis and foster productive collaboration in virtual team environments.
Part-time remote data analysts often encounter challenges related to time management, communication across different teams, and maintaining data security. Effectively prioritizing tasks and setting structured work hours can help ensure deadlines are met, even with a flexible schedule. It’s important to proactively communicate with managers and team members to stay aligned on project requirements and deliverables, making use of collaboration tools like Slack or Microsoft Teams. Staying organized and keeping up with data privacy protocols will also help you maintain the quality and integrity of your analysis while working remotely. We are seeking experienced and reliable Clinical Trial Raters to conduct standardized psychiatric assessments for a clinical trial in Borderline Personality Disorder (BPD). The rater will be responsible for administering validated clinicianrated instruments, ensuring high-quality, consistent data collection in accordance with the study protocol, GCP, and regulatory requirements.
This role requires strong clinical judgment, experience with psychiatric populations, and the ability to maintain objectivity and interrater reliability across multiple assessments and time points.
